Explosion-proof emergency device of aluminum alloy tire
Technical Field
The utility model relates to a technical field of car accessories especially relates to an explosion-proof emergency device of aluminum alloy tire.
Background
As is well known, an aluminum alloy tire explosion-proof emergency device is an auxiliary device which is mounted on an automobile hub, can prevent a tire from falling off when the tire bursts, and protects the hub and the tire, and is widely used in the field of automobile accessories; the existing aluminum alloy tire explosion-proof emergency device is inconvenient to disassemble and assemble, and the installation firmness is poor, so that the use reliability is low.

Detailed Description

Referring to fig. 1-5, the utility model discloses an explosion-proof emergency device of aluminum alloy tire, including the hoop, the hoop includes first arc hoop piece 1, second arc hoop piece 2, third arc hoop piece 3, fourth arc hoop piece 4, first arc hoop piece 1, second arc hoop piece 2, third arc hoop piece 3 and fourth arc hoop piece 4 enclose into the ring-type along clockwise end to end in proper order, and the junction of first arc hoop piece 1 and second arc hoop piece 2 is provided with adjusting device, adjusting device includes first connecting plate 5 with first arc hoop piece 1 end connection and second connecting plate 6 with second arc hoop piece 2 end connection to all be provided with the intercommunicating pore on first connecting plate 5 and second connecting plate 6, be provided with adjusting bolt 7 and adjusting nut 8 between first connecting plate 5 and the second connecting plate 6, the junction of second arc hoop piece 2 and third arc hoop piece 3, The joint of the third arc hoop piece 3 and the fourth arc hoop piece 4 and the joint of the fourth arc hoop piece 4 and the first arc hoop piece 1 are both provided with a hook structure, a plurality of groups of fastening devices are arranged on the side wall of the hoop at equal intervals, each fastening device comprises an adjusting column 9, a threaded rod 10 and a foot pad 11, a plurality of groups of internally and externally communicated mounting holes are uniformly arranged on the hoop at equal angles, a ball bearing 12 is fixedly arranged in the mounting hole, one end of the adjusting column 9 penetrates through the ball bearing 12 from the outer side of the hoop to extend into the inner side of the hoop, a thread groove is arranged at one end of the inner side of the adjusting column 9, an inner hexagonal counter bore 13 is arranged at one end of the outer side of the adjusting column 9, one end of the threaded rod 10 is fixedly connected with the end part of the foot pad 11, the other end of the threaded rod 10 is inserted into and screwed into a thread groove of the adjusting column 9, and one end of the foot pad 11, which is far away from the threaded rod 10, is provided with an arc surface structure; the hoop is arranged into a first arc hoop sheet 1, a second arc hoop sheet 2, a third arc hoop sheet 3 and a fourth arc hoop sheet 4 which are connected end to end, the second arc hoop sheet 2 and the third arc hoop sheet 3, the third arc hoop sheet 3 and the fourth arc hoop sheet 4 and the fourth arc hoop sheet and the first arc hoop sheet 1 are connected through a hook structure, the first arc hoop sheet 1 and the second arc hoop sheet 2 are connected through an adjusting bolt 7 and an adjusting nut 8, disassembly and assembly are convenient, and the diameter of the hoop can be finely adjusted by adjusting the adjusting bolt 7 and the adjusting nut 8, so that the hoop is suitable for hubs of different specifications; preliminarily fix the hoop in wheel hub's annular groove department, then rotate the interior hexagonal counter bore 13 of adjusting post 9 through the interior hexagonal screwdriver and rotate adjusting post 9, make pad foot 11 and wheel hub's annular groove fully paste tightly through the cooperation of adjusting post 9 and threaded rod 10 to improve the fastness of installation, improve the reliability in utilization.
The utility model discloses an aluminum alloy tire explosion-proof emergency device, the outer lane of hoop is fixed and is provided with multiunit fixed rubber slab 14, fixed rubber slab 14 is the arc structure, and is provided with dentate structure 15 in the outer lane of fixed rubber slab 14; the fixed rubber plate 14 can support and limit the tire after the tire burst, so that the tire and the hub are protected, and the tire is prevented from falling off to enable the hub to be directly rubbed with the ground.
The utility model discloses an aluminum alloy tire explosion-proof emergency device, the hook structure includes the coupling hook 16 and the connector 17 that cooperate each other, the coupling hook 16 and the connector 17 are all integrated with the hoop, and the end of the coupling hook 16 is bent outwards; the connecting hook 16 is matched with the connecting port 17 in a hanging manner, so that the installation is convenient.
The utility model discloses an aluminum alloy tire explosion-proof emergency device, the hoop, upper junction plate, lower junction plate are the aluminum alloy material, adjusting post 9 and threaded rod 10 are the stainless steel material, pad foot 11 is stainless steel plectane 18, the one end of stainless steel plectane 18 is fixedly connected with threaded rod 10, the other end of stainless steel plectane 18 is provided with rubber layer 19; the hoop made of the aluminum alloy material is light and firm in structure and improves practicability.
The utility model relates to an explosion-proof emergency device for aluminum alloy tires, the interior of the fixed rubber plate 14 is filled with a glass fiber layer; the wear resistance of the fixing rubber sheet 14 is improved by the glass fiber layer.
The utility model discloses an aluminum alloy tire explosion-proof emergency device, when using, through setting the hoop to end first arc hoop piece 1, second arc hoop piece 2, third arc hoop piece 3 and fourth arc hoop piece 4, second arc hoop piece 2 and third arc hoop piece 3, third arc hoop piece 3 and fourth arc hoop piece 4, fourth arc hoop piece and first arc hoop piece 1 all link to each other through the couple structure, first arc hoop piece 1 and second arc hoop piece 2 are connected through adjusting bolt 7 and adjusting nut 8, conveniently carry out the dismouting, through adjusting bolt 7 and adjusting nut 8, can finely tune the diameter of hoop to adapt to the wheel hub of different specifications; preliminarily fix the hoop at wheel hub's annular groove department, then rotate the interior hexagonal counter bore 13 of adjusting post 9 through the interior hexagonal screwdriver and rotate adjusting post 9, cooperation through adjusting post 9 and threaded rod 10 makes pad foot 11 fully paste tightly with wheel hub's annular groove, thereby improve the fastness of installation, improve the reliability of use, can support the tire spacing after blowing out through fixed rubber slab 14, thereby improve and protect tire and wheel hub, prevent that the tire from droing and make wheel hub directly rub with ground, through hookup cooperation of coupling hook 16 and connector 17, easy to assemble, the hoop of aluminum alloy material, the structure is light and handy firm, and the practicability is improved.
